Stress can significantly impact weight loss efforts. When stressed, the body releases cortisol, a hormone that triggers cravings for high-calorie, comfort foods. This can lead to emotional eating and overconsumption, hindering weight loss progress. Additionally, stress can disrupt sleep patterns, affecting metabolism and appetite regulation. Chronic stress may also reduce the motivation to engage in physical activity. Managing stress is crucial for successful weight loss. Incorporating relaxation techniques such as meditation, yoga, or deep breathing can help. Prioritizing self-care, getting enough sleep, and seeking support from friends or professionals can mitigate stress's adverse effects on weight loss, promoting a healthier and more balanced lifestyle.
